In the ‘Index of Eight Core Industries’, which one of the following is given the highest weight?

[UPSC Civil Services Exam – 2015 Prelims]

(a) Coal production

(b) Electricity generation

(c) Fertilizer production

(d) Steel production


Answer: (b)        

Explanation:

  • The monthly Index of Eight Core Industries (ICI) is a production volume index. ICI measures collective and individual performance of production in selected eight core industries viz. Coal, Crude Oil, Natural Gas, Refinery Products, Fertilizers, Steel, Cement and Electricity.
  • It is compiled and released by Office of the Economic Adviser (OEA), Department of Industrial Policy & Promotion (DIPP), and Ministry of Commerce & Industry.
  • The Index of Industrial Production (IIP) is an index that shows the growth rates in different industry groups of the economy in a fixed period of time.
  • The eight core industries in decreasing order of their weightage: Refinery Products> Electricity> Steel> Coal> Crude Oil> Natural Gas> Cement> Fertilizers.
